Abstract

214,602. Julian, P. April 17, 1923, [Convention date]. Spray carburettors. -The supply of additional air is controlled according to atmospheric temperature by a valve influenced bv the vapour pressure of a liquid contained in an expansible chamber. A throttle valve 2 rotatable in the casing 1 has an ordinary bearing 3 and a special bearing in a plate 4 provided with a passage which places the extra air conduit 6 leading to the induction pipe, in communication with an aperture 8 controlled by a valve 10. The extra air enters through apertures 19. The valve 10 is connected to a flexible diaphragm 13 soldered to the upper edge of a chamber 14 containing the liquid. The diaphragm, which may be loaded by a spring, can only occupy the two positions in which the valve 10 is fully open and completely closed.
